Abstract
A stethoscope head adapter for a diaphragm microphone is provided. The adapter creates a smaller surface area for the diaphragm microphone without diminishing the acoustical reception by the diaphragm of normal or pathological conditions in a patient. The adapter is made from an elastomeric material to permit easy placement on the stethoscope head and to provide an effective acoustical seal against the uneven surface of the skin of a patient. A secondary diaphragm may also be provided in the adapter to focus the reception by the diaphragm microphone of the specific frequencies desired to be monitored. With the adapter on the stethoscope head, the intensities of sound at frequencies not desired to be monitored are attenuated when compared with the use of the stethoscope head without the adapter present.

8. A stethoscope head, comprising:
a body bounded by a releasable engagement perimeter;
a diaphragm in said body having a diaphragm sound receiving surface area; and
an adapter releasably engaging said perimeter and having a cover terminating in a central opening having an area less than said diaphragm sound receiving surface area.
